2. The Best Dog Breeds for First-Time Owners

If you're a beginner dog owner, certain breeds are well-known for being particularly friendly, adaptable, and easy to care for. Here are some of the best dog breeds for beginners:

  • Labrador Retriever: Known for their friendly nature and intelligence, Labradors are one of the most popular choices for first-time dog owners. They are easy to train and make great family pets.
  • Golden Retriever: Like Labs, Golden Retrievers are easy-going and trainable, with a gentle temperament. Their friendly nature makes them perfect companions for new dog owners.
  • Cavalier King Charles Spaniel: Small, affectionate, and easy to handle, Cavaliers are a great choice for beginners. They love companionship and are easy to train, making them ideal pets for first-time owners.
  • Beagle: Beagles are friendly, playful, and relatively low-maintenance. They are also great for families and individuals who have an active lifestyle but need a dog that is not overly demanding.
  • Pug: Pugs are small, affectionate dogs that require minimal grooming and are easygoing in temperament. They thrive on companionship and adapt well to different living situations.

These breeds are well-suited for new dog owners, providing a blend of ease in training and loving companionship. Remember, each dog has its own personality, but these breeds generally require less effort to manage and train compared to other more high-energy or independent breeds.

3. Why Training Matters: Easy-to-Train Dogs for Beginners

Training is one of the most important aspects of raising a dog, and it’s especially crucial for first-time dog owners. Some breeds are easier to train because they are highly intelligent and eager to please, while others may require more patience and consistency.

When choosing a breed, it's important to consider how easy it will be to train them. Breeds like the Labrador Retriever, Golden Retriever, and Beagle are known for being highly trainable, as they are eager to please and respond well to positive reinforcement. These dogs will quickly learn basic commands, which helps establish a solid relationship between you and your pet.

On the other hand, breeds that are more independent or stubborn may require more patience and persistence in training. But with consistent effort and proper training methods, these dogs can still thrive in a beginner’s home. A good training routine is essential in creating a well-behaved dog, regardless of the breed.
